副词 adv.
  1. In the sense of. conjunctive,idiomatic,not-comparable
    — "bow" as in the weapon, not the front of a ship
  2. In the sense of.; As pronounced in. conjunctive,idiomatic,not-comparable
    — That's B as in boy.
  3. By which I mean; that is to say. informal,not-comparable
    — The TV is completely broken, as in I can't get any picture at all.
  4. Used to emphasize a point.; added after a point has been made Philippines,not-comparable
    — He's so tall, as in!
  5. Used to emphasize a point.; asked if the prior statement is really true; really Philippines,not-comparable
    — A: It's so traffic a while ago. B: As in? A: Yes, it took me an hour to pass through!
  6. Used other than figuratively or idiomatically: see as, in. not-comparable
    — In Sweden, as in most countries, ...
